Self-cannibalism is not for the faint-hearted. And there are only eight recorded instances of it in the world. Most recently, a man from New Zealand cut off his little finger and ate it. It’s interesting to note that he’s a vegetarian.
The unnamed mentally ill man later described his action as “ultimately, a very stupid idea”. Well that’s perspective, at least.
Want to know how he did it? He allegedly applied a tourniquet to his little finger, cut it off with a saw, cooked it with vegetables and ate it.
He was 28 at the time of the incident, and suffering from depression, insomnia and suicidal thoughts.
The man said he regretted eating his finger but that his bizarre actions were a desperate cry for attention from mental health authorities.
He told the press his current flatmates were curious about the experience.
“They asked me ‘what did it taste like? Does it taste like chicken or pork?”
Unfortunately he couldn’t answer because he hadn’t eaten chicken or pork in such a long time. He’s a Buddhist vegetarian.
